Offline programming is in which all the cell, the robot and every one of the machines or devices while in the workspace are mapped graphically. The robot can then be moved on display screen and the method simulated. A robotics simulator is applied to make embedded apps for a robot, without the need of depending on the physical Procedure of your robot arm and conclusion effector.

Serial architectures a.k.a. serial manipulators are quite common industrial robots; They are really intended as a number of inbound links connected by motor-actuated joints that reach from the base to an end-effector. SCARA, Stanford manipulators are usual examples of this classification.
